- What is Interactive Brokers Group, Inc.'s f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ity?
- Interactive Brokers Group, Inc. (IBKR) reported f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ity of $41.89B in Q1 2026.
- How has Interactive Brokers Group, Inc.'s f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ity changed year-over-year?
- Interactive Brokers Group, Inc.'s f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ity increased by 42.5% year-over-year, from $29.39B to $41.89B.
- What is the long-term trend for Interactive Brokers Group, Inc.'s f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Interactive Brokers Group, Inc.'s fair value of securities restricted in relation to customer activity has grown at a -1.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$27.82B to $26.52B.
